NORFOLK - Two people are in jail on several charges after police found drugs in a car during a traffic stop.

The Norfolk Police Division says officers performed a traffic stop just after midnight on Wednesday on a car on North 6th Street for a traffic violation.

The driver was identified as 20-year-old Devin Childs, of Wayne.

NPD says the officer could smell marijuana coming from the car.

A check of Childs’ license showed that it was revoked.

There were three other passengers in the car; one adult and two juveniles.

The other adult was identified as 22-year-old Holly Andersen, of Wayne.

Childs was taken into custody for driving during revocation.

During a search, officers found two bags of marijuana, a scale, small plastic baggies, and used marijuana cigar blunts.

Both Anderson and Childs were arrested for possession of marijuana with intent to distribute, child abuse, and contributing to the delinquency of a child.
